What class is a snail classified in?

Class: Gastropoda The class gastropoda includes slugs and snails. The majority have a shell that the animal can withdraw its body into and are called snails.

How do snails communicate?

Snails have two tentacles on their heads which are used to communicate with others through touch. Both snails and slugs leave a trail of mucus which can be interpreted by other individuals. Apart from that, they also communicate through chemical residue.

How did the channeled apple snail get to indiana?

Sometimes the snails are introduced illegally by smugglers, usually as a human food resource. The most frequent local dispersal mechanism of Channeled Apple Snails is the escape (or even release) of these snails from aquaculture-facility confinement. Another method is the release of domestic aquarium snails.

Do spiders eat snails?

A review of several hundred papers on spider feeding habits revealed that species from several families kill and devour slugs and snails in the laboratory and/or field. … The spiders that eat gastropods are species with broad diets composed predominantly of arthropod prey.

Do snails live in minnesota?

North America is home to more than 1,200 species of land snails. Minnesota harbors about 90 species. They live on prairies, in forests, and near swamps and rocky bluffs and boulders. Land snails are so poorly known that until 30 years ago only one Minnesota species had a common English name—the cherrystone.

Are all snails edible?

Not all species of land snail are edible, and many are too small – not worthwhile to prepare and cook them. Among the edible species, the palatability of the flesh varies. In France, the species eaten most often is Helix pomatia. The “petit-gris” Cornu aspersa and Helix lucorum are also eaten.
